Record and development:
On-line poker emerged when you look at the late 1990s due to breakthroughs in technology while the net. The very first on-line poker space, globe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a little but enthusiastic community. But was at early 2000s that on-line poker experienced exponential development, primarily due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Financial and Social Impact:
The development of internet poker has had a substantial economic impact globally. Online poker systems produce substantial revenue through rake fees, event entry fees, and marketing. This revenue has generated task creation and assets in gaming business. Furthermore, internet poker has added to an increase in taxation income for governments in which it is managed, supporting general public services.

From a personal perspective, on-line poker features fostered a global poker community, bridging geographical obstacles. People from diverse backgrounds and places can interact and contend, fostering a feeling of camaraderie. Online poker in addition has played an important role to advertise the game's popularity and attracting new players, ultimately causing the growth of poker business all together.
